I see Davis as the offensive loss equivalent to the departure of Edmunds on defense. Davis was a starter the last 2 seasons had very good games but also was what he was and played a certain way. A way the defense knew how to stop or contain. Samuel offers diversity in attack. Has the speed to run past coverage while also experience running routes and receiving handoffs out of the backfield. Samuel makes the offense harder to defend and excels at beating man. Buffalo has struggled to beat man if Diggs is taken away. -

He said his main focus is ball placement and hitting his guys on the run to get more yac. That is what he said the last 2 years. The deep ball is what it is. A low percentage play. This year I dont remember 1 wr making a contested catch down field. The dbs made more plays on the ball than the wrs this year. Years past Diggs was 70/30 80/20. This past year it was 10/90. Concentrate on the short and intermediate it is 90% of the plays. The most accurate deep balls can be drops and the miss timed bad balls can be catches or penalties. -
